From 9d5ae34aa9cfaa03d205f4a7a268d5ee9b33c57e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Steve French <stfrench@microsoft.com>
Date: Fri, 20 Aug 2021 18:10:36 -0500
Subject: [PATCH] oid_registry: Add OIDs for missing Spnego auth mechanisms to
 Macs

In testing mounts to Macs, noticed that the OIDS for some
GSSAPI/SPNEGO auth mechanisms sent by the server were not
recognized and were missing from the header.

Reviewed-by: Paulo Alcantara (SUSE) <pc@cjr.nz>
Signed-off-by: Steve French <stfrench@microsoft.com>
---
 include/linux/oid_registry.h | 7 +++++++
 1 file changed, 7 insertions(+)

diff --git a/include/linux/oid_registry.h b/include/linux/oid_registry.h
index 3d8db1f6a5db..0f4a8903922a 100644
--- a/include/linux/oid_registry.h
+++ b/include/linux/oid_registry.h
@@ -70,6 +70,9 @@ enum OID {
 
 	OID_spnego,			/* 1.3.6.1.5.5.2 */
 
+	OID_IAKerb,			/* 1.3.6.1.5.2.5 */
+	OID_PKU2U,			/* 1.3.5.1.5.2.7 */
+	OID_Scram,			/* 1.3.6.1.5.5.14 */
 	OID_certAuthInfoAccess,		/* 1.3.6.1.5.5.7.1.1 */
 	OID_sha1,			/* 1.3.14.3.2.26 */
 	OID_id_ansip384r1,		/* 1.3.132.0.34 */
@@ -104,6 +107,10 @@ enum OID {
 	OID_authorityKeyIdentifier,	/* 2.5.29.35 */
 	OID_extKeyUsage,		/* 2.5.29.37 */
 
+	/* Heimdal mechanisms */
+	OID_NetlogonMechanism,		/* 1.2.752.43.14.2 */
+	OID_appleLocalKdcSupported,	/* 1.2.752.43.14.3 */
+
 	/* EC-RDSA */
 	OID_gostCPSignA,		/* 1.2.643.2.2.35.1 */
 	OID_gostCPSignB,		/* 1.2.643.2.2.35.2 */
